If I'm using this sentence should it be "an one" or "a one"? Give a one-of-a-kind gift...
I believe you should use an instead of a previous to the word one. This is because one's first letter starts with a vowel.
You should write: a one-of-a-kind gift. "one" starts with a "w" sound. It is all about the sound not the letter. Read more about using a and an.
